Division number 66 Dissolution and Calling of Parliament Bill — Clause 2 — Revival of Prerogative Powers to Dissolve Parliament and to Call a new Parliament

A majority of MPs voted for the monarch, rather than MPs, to have power to dissolve a Parliament, and prompt an early election.

Aye: 312 MPs

No: 162 MPs
